Goji Berry is a deciduous shrub with slender, arching branches and narrow grey-green leaves, producing soft purple star-shaped flowers in summer followed by bright orange-red berries in early autumn. It grows well in borders, kitchen gardens, or as part of an edible hedge, bringing both ornamental value and a valuable harvest. Can be trained up against a wall or allowed to roam wild.
The berries have a mildly sweet, slightly tangy flavour and are traditionally dried for teas, cereals, and snacking, though they can also be eaten fresh when fully ripe. Rich in antioxidants, vitamins, and amino acids, they’ve long been prized in herbal and traditional Chinese medicine. Harvest berries once fully coloured and soft, and then dehydrate for the best flavour.
Goji is drought tolerant once established, low maintenance, and cold hardy. It thrives in well-drained soil with plenty of sun and benefits from light pruning to keep growth compact. Hardy, healthy, and highly rewarding, Goji Berry is a long-term addition to any productive garden.
